mq_synth.js:
- jitter was only used as a static initial phase offset (inaudible);
now drives per-sample LCG frequency perturbation (±jitter fraction of
instantaneous freq) in both sinusoidal (integratePhase path) and
resonator modes (separate jitterSeed, independent from noise excitation)
- disableJitter option now correctly gates jitter to 0 in both modes
(was never read before)
viewer.js / app.js:
- remove invalidatePartialSpectrum() and onResonatorParamChange callback;
replace with viewer.onGetSynthOpts callback, called inside
_computePartialSpectrum to pull fresh synthOpts at compute time
- all UI changes (resonator r/gain, forceResonator, globalR/gain,
forceRGain, sinusoidal params) now use viewer.render() as the single
invalidation path — no more split between render() and
invalidatePartialSpectrum()
handoff(Gemini): jitter active on both synth modes; spectrum always sees
fresh synthOpts via onGetSynthOpts; viewer.render() is the only
invalidation path needed.
